Nutrition & ingredients

Ingredients

serves 6
  • 10 oz dry package of lo mein noodles
  • 1/3 cup reduced sodium chicken broth
  • 2 tablespoons low sodium soy sauce
  • 2 tablespoons Hoisin sauce
  • 1 tablespoon oyster sauce
  • 2 teaspoons sesame oil
  • 2 teaspoons cornstarch
  • 1 tablespoon canola oil
  • 1 lb raw boneless skinless chicken breasts (cut into bite-sized pieces)
  • Salt and black pepper (to taste)
  • 1 small onion (finely sliced)
  • 2 garlic cloves (minced)
  • 1 teaspoon minced ginger root
  • 1 ½ cups finely chopped napa cabbage
  • 1 cup snow peas
  • ½ cup shredded/julienned carrots
  • 1 scallion (finely chopped)
